Output 42998a23583e486bbac4ae95ab6794fcd8283645c70c81a95db69ba016ac96a2:47

value
2014
script pubkey
OP_0 OP_PUSHBYTES_20 00a43c9d6309ecd5479987984c95ec9afa97e622
address
tb1qqzjre8trp8kd23ues7vye90vntaf0e3zu9g9ht
transaction
42998a23583e486bbac4ae95ab6794fcd8283645c70c81a95db69ba016ac96a2